Percussion rudiments are fundamental rhythmic patterns forming the technical foundation of drumming․ The 40 International Drum Rudiments, including rolls, flams, and drags, are essential for mastery․ Practicing from slow (open) to fast (close) tempos enhances technical proficiency and musical expression, as outlined in the percussion rudiments PDF․

Overview of the 40 International Drum Rudiments

The 40 International Drum Rudiments, as outlined in the percussion rudiments PDF, are a comprehensive collection of rhythmic patterns that form the technical backbone of drumming․ These rudiments include traditional designs, such as the single stroke roll and paradiddle, as well as modern additions from drum corps, orchestral, and contemporary styles․ They are categorized into rolls, flams, drags, and other advanced patterns like the flamacue and ratamacue․ Each rudiment is practiced from slow (open) to fast (close) tempos to build precision and control․ The list was compiled by the Percussive Arts Society (PAS) and serves as a universal standard for percussionists worldwide, providing a structured path for mastering technical and musical proficiency across snare drum, drum set, and other percussion instruments․

Importance of Practicing Rudiments in Percussion

Practicing percussion rudiments is essential for developing technical mastery and musical expression․ Rudiments, such as rolls, flams, and drags, form the building blocks of rhythmic precision and control․ By practicing slowly (open) and progressing to faster (close) tempos, percussionists build strength, coordination, and consistency․ The percussion rudiments PDF emphasizes that mastering these patterns enhances overall musicianship and adaptability across instruments like snare drum, drum set, and timpani․ Consistent practice also improves timing, dynamics, and articulation, preparing percussionists for diverse musical genres and performance settings․ Rudiments are the foundation for achieving excellence in percussion, whether in classical, contemporary, or ensemble contexts․

Roll Rudiments

Roll rudiments form the foundation of percussion technique, emphasizing rhythmic accuracy and stroke control․ They include single stroke rolls, double stroke rolls, triple stroke rolls, and multiple bounce rolls․ Single stroke rolls involve alternating strokes (RLRL), while double stroke rolls use consecutive strokes with the same hand (RRLL)․ Triple stroke rolls combine three strokes in a row, and multiple bounce rolls create sustained rhythmic patterns․ Practicing these rudiments from slow (open) to fast (close) tempos improves technical proficiency and musical expression․ The percussion rudiments PDF provides detailed notation and exercises for mastering roll rudiments, essential for snare drum, drum set, and other percussion instruments․ These patterns are fundamental to building speed, coordination, and overall drumming versatility․

The Percussive Arts Society (PAS) International Drum Rudiments List

The Percussive Arts Society (PAS) International Drum Rudiments List is a comprehensive guide to the 40 fundamental drum rudiments․ Compiled by a committee of expert percussionists, this list expands beyond the traditional 26 rudiments to include drum corps, orchestral, and contemporary patterns․ It serves as a standardized reference for drummers worldwide, providing clarity and consistency in rudimental study․ The list is categorized into rolls, flams, drags, and other advanced rudiments like paradiddles and flamacues․ Widely regarded as the definitive resource, it is often downloaded as a percussion rudiments PDF for easy access․ This document is essential for educators, students, and professionals seeking to master the technical foundation of drumming․

How a Dehumidifier Works

A dehumidifier draws moist air over a refrigerated coil, condensing moisture into water, which is collected․ Dry air is then circulated back into the room․

3․1 Basic Principles of Dehumidification

A dehumidifier removes moisture from the air by drawing it over a refrigerated coil, causing water vapor to condense into liquid․ The dry air is then circulated back into the room․ The process involves refrigeration, where the coil cools the air below its dew point, effectively extracting humidity․ Proper operation requires temperatures between 41°F (5°C) and 89°F (32°C) for optimal efficiency․ Always allow the unit to stand upright for at least an hour before use to ensure the refrigerant stabilizes․

3․2 Airflow and Moisture Removal Process

The dehumidifier draws moist air through its vents, which then passes over a cold refrigerated coil․ This causes water vapor to condense into liquid droplets, collected in a built-in reservoir․ The dry air is reheated slightly and circulated back into the room․ Continuous airflow ensures efficient moisture removal, with the fan operating in a cycle to maintain desired humidity levels․ Proper placement and upright positioning are crucial for optimal performance and to prevent water leakage during operation․

Rider Height and Weight

Rider height and weight are critical factors in determining the ideal snowboard height. Generally, a snowboard should reach between your chin and nose when stood on its tail. For riders between 5ft 4in and 6ft tall, board lengths typically range from 135cm to 160cm. Weight also plays a role, as lighter riders may prefer shorter boards for easier maneuverability, while heavier riders benefit from longer boards for better floatation in powder. A common guideline is to adjust the board length based on weight: riders up to 120 lbs may prefer shorter boards (140-150cm), while those over 150 lbs often opt for longer boards (155-165cm). Balancing height and weight ensures optimal performance and control, whether carving groomed trails or exploring off-piste terrain.

Weight-Based Adjustments

Weight significantly influences snowboard size, as it affects floatation and stability. Lighter riders may prefer shorter boards for easier maneuverability, while heavier riders need longer boards for better control. A general guideline is:
– Up to 80 lbs (36 kg): 132-137cm
– 80-120 lbs (36-54 kg): 138-145cm
– 120-150 lbs (54-68 kg): 146-152cm
– 150-180 lbs (68-82 kg): 153-158cm
– Over 180 lbs (82 kg): 159cm+.
These adjustments ensure the board’s flex and performance align with the rider’s weight, optimizing responsiveness and stability. Weight-based recommendations are most effective when combined with height and riding style considerations for a personalized fit.

Width Based on Riding Style

Your snowboard’s width should align with your riding style to ensure optimal performance. Freestyle and park riders often prefer narrower boards (23-25cm) for easier maneuverability and spins. All-mountain riders benefit from medium widths (25-26.5cm), offering stability and versatility across various terrains. Powder riders typically opt for wider boards (26.5cm+), enhancing floatation in deep snow. Boot size also plays a role; larger boots require wider boards to prevent drag. Consider your primary terrain and how you ride—aggressive carving may demand a different width than casual cruising. Proper width ensures better edge hold, smoother turns, and reduced fatigue. Always cross-reference your boot size and riding style with the board’s specifications for the best fit. This balance is crucial for maximizing your snowboarding experience and maintaining control in all conditions.
